Monolithic columns, in which the reliable assist is an individual, porous rod, provide column efficiencies akin to a packed capillary column even though allowing for faster circulation prices. A monolithic column—which usually is similar in dimension to a traditional packed column, although scaled-down, capillary columns also can be found—is prepared by forming the mono- lithic rod inside a mildew and masking it with PTFE tubing or maybe a polymer resin.
